TP-Link Archer AX23 Router Design
The TP-Link Archer AX23 router is a dual-band Wi-Fi 6 AX1800 router and this is its blue cardboard box shown below. Pulling the box’s flap, we got to the Archer AX 23 router, a power adapter, an RJ45 Ethernet cable and a quick installation guide.
The Archer AX23 router is glossy black and matte. It has a cool, matte finish with a glossy contrasting detail for a futuristic, geometric feel. The top and side of the router are also perforated to provide air access. On the front, you’ll find a number of LEDs, and on the back you will find the power port, power button, WAN port, 4 Gigabit Ethernet ports, and WPS/Wi-Fi and reset buttons. There are also 4 antennas. Bottom The bottom has many vent holes to release heat and show the router’s system info.

TP-Link Archer AX23 Router Specifications
Brand | TP-Link |
Model Name | Archer AX23 |
Standards and Protocols | Wi-Fi 6 IEEE 802.11ax/ac/n/a 5 GHz IEEE 802.11ax/n/b/g 2.4 GHz |
WiFi Speeds | AX1800 5 GHz: 1201 Mbps (802.11ax) 2.4 GHz: 574 Mbps (802.11ax) |
Dimensions (W×D×H) | 10.2 × 5.3 ×1.5 in (260.2 × 135.0 × 38.6 mm) |
Special Feature | Beamforming, QoS, Alexa Compatible, Access Point Mode, WPS, Parental Control |
Frequency Band Class | Dual-Band |
Wireless Communication Standard | 802.11n, 802.11ax, 802.11b, 802.11ac, 802.11g |
Compatible Devices | Gaming Console, Personal Computer, Tablet, Smartphone |
Frequency | 5 GHz |
Included Components | Wi-Fi Router Archer AX23 Power Adapter RJ45 Ethernet Cable Quick Installation Guide |
